Inveravante is the single-family office established by the late Galician entrepreneur Manuel Jove, founder of the Spanish real estate giant Fadesa. Based in A Coruña, Spain, Inveravante was created in 2007 following the sale of Fadesa to Martinsa, and it serves as the principal vehicle for managing the Jove family’s diversified investments across multiple sectors and geographies. The office operates as a global investment group with a presence in Europe, North Africa, and Latin America. Its core areas of focus include real estate development, energy and infrastructure, agribusiness, and financial investments. Within real estate, Inveravante develops high-end residential, commercial, and hospitality properties under its Avantespacia and Vante Asset Management brands, with a footprint in both urban centers and resort destinations. In the energy sector, the office has built a portfolio of renewable energy assets, primarily wind and solar, supporting the family’s long-term commitment to sustainability and future-focused infrastructure. Its agribusiness division focuses on high-quality olive oil and wine production, reinforcing its alignment with premium and export-driven Spanish agricultural products. Financially, Inveravante maintains a portfolio of listed securities, private equity, and structured investments, guided by a conservative and long-term strategy. The firm often co-invests with institutional partners and maintains a reputation for disciplined capital allocation. Inveravante continues to be run by the Jove family and a seasoned team of professional managers. The office blends entrepreneurial agility with institutional rigor, reflecting the vision and legacy of its founder. Known for its discretion and selective public engagement, it is regarded as one of the most influential family offices in Spain, shaping sectors as diverse as real estate, energy, and agri-food.

Understanding the Investment Strategies of Hospitality Investors

Acquisition and Development Focus

Hospitality investors in Europe often employ a strategy centered around the acquisition and development of hospitality properties. These investors seek out underperforming assets with the potential for renovation and repositioning, allowing them to enhance value and improve operational efficiency. By investing in properties located in strategic locations, such as major cities and tourist hotspots, they can capitalize on high occupancy rates and increased revenue streams.

Diversification of Asset Portfolio

Diversification is a key component of the investment strategy for hospitality investors. By maintaining a diverse portfolio of assets, including hotels, resorts, and serviced apartments, they mitigate risks associated with market fluctuations and economic downturns. This approach ensures a balanced risk-return profile and contributes to the overall stability of their investment portfolios.

Regional and Geographic Presence

European hospitality investors often have a strong regional focus, investing in properties across multiple European countries. This geographic diversification allows them to tap into various markets and benefit from differing economic conditions and tourism trends. By understanding the unique characteristics of each market, they can tailor their investment strategies to maximize returns.
